Sound's very simple, but your own your way to becoming better.
The Piano would have sounded better if it had some sort of reverb, and a minor delay, would have that classic trance piano sound.
Didn't like the Base very much. seemed simple, but its a start, so no complaints.

Fail.

"FL for industrial. fl relaly knows how to give yours ong distortion, usually in a bad way"

You have no idea the true power of FL Studio, Some talented young Producers use FL Studio, and excel more than other people who attempt to make Trance with other DAW's, eg: Sonar 8, Cubase, Logic Pro, Pro tools.

In reality, there is no universal Digital Audio Workstationto make trance, or any side-genre. It all comes down to Skill, and Perseverance.

GBand is horrible btw, Loops? You can never grow from Garageband and expand, and thats because you're limited to Loops, Only really being able to change pitch and the sort. Even if you plugged your piano in on a midi setup, those sounds that are built into GBand can barely be changed.

You have alot to learn, but we all start somewhere
